okta, Make sure you need the API. "clientData": "eyAiY2hhbGxlbmdlIjogImFYLS1wMTlibldWcUlnY25HU0hLIiwgIm9yaWdpbiI6ICJodHRwczpcL1wvc25hZ2FuZGxhLm9rdGFwcmV2aWV3LmNvbSIsICJ0eXAiOiAibmF2aWdhdG9yLmlkLmZpbmlzaEVucm9sbG1lbnQiIH0=", I am working for AngularJS web application and we need to implement the OKTA authentication from Web Api. ""https://${yourOktaDomain}/api/v1/authn/factors/ostfm3hPNYSOIOIVTQWY/verify""https://${yourOktaDomain}/api/v1/users/00u15s1KDETTQMQYABRL/factors/opfbtzzrjgwauUsxO0g4/lifecycle/activate/email""https://${yourOktaDomain}/api/v1/users/00u15s1KDETTQMQYABRL/factors/opfbtzzrjgwauUsxO0g4/lifecycle/activate/sms""https://${yourOktaDomain}/api/v1/users/00u15s1KDETTQMQYABRL/factors/opfbtzzrjgwauUsxO0g4/qr/00Ji8qVBNJD4LmjYy1WZO2VbNqvvPdaCVua-1qjypa" dd, yyyy' }} {{ parent.linkDate | date:'MMM. "factorType": "question", "profile": { Please try again. "password": "correcthorsebatterystaple" -->'https://${yourOktaDomain}/api/v1/authn/factors/dsflnpo99zpfMyaij0g3/lifecycle/duoCallback'"201111XUk7La2gw5r5PV1IhU4WSd0fV6mvNYdlJoeqjuyej7S83x3Hr""shvjvW2Fi2GtCJb33nm0105EISG9lf2Jg0jWl42URM6vtDH8-AhnoSKfpoHfAf0kJMaCx13glfdxiLFuPW_1bw""https://${yourOktaDomain}/api/v1/authn/factors/fuf8y2l4n5mfH0UWe0h7/verify"// Use the version and credentialId from factor profile object// Call the U2F javascript API to get signed assertion from the U2F token"201111XUk7La2gw5r5PV1IhU4WSd0fV6mvNYdlJoeqjuyej7S83x3Hr""AZBXkiL5GrhfSvLeS4MHSvTVC_1ZLPcwI4SKKqKF1sd9TL_UFoQliUKu00to6slexSOZ9oh1h54BbTXPA343qHBF""https://${yourOktaDomain}/api/v1/authn/factors/fwfbaopNw5CCGJTu20g4/verify""AZBXkiL5GrhfSvLeS4MHSvTVC_1ZLPcwI4SKKqKF1sd9TL_UFoQliUKu00to6slexSOZ9oh1h54BbTXPA343qHBF""5V1tI15ifCWhZSLvv9szL4HjRk-vpBYYg86n4LZlVg5bAg2_UnP-vjc4ix60Uh9ehLluB7KsMzmEU7y_TuRaJA""https://${yourOktaDomain}/api/v1/authn/factors/webauthn/verify"// For factorId verification, convert activation object's challenge nonce from string to binary// For factorType verification, the challenge nonce would be stored in challenge.challenge instead// Call the WebAuthn javascript API to get signed assertion from the WebAuthn authenticator// Get the client data, authenticator data, and signature data from callback result, convert from binary to string'{
}'"https://${yourOktaDomain}/assets/img/logos/salesforce_logo.dbd7e0b4de118a1dae1c39d60a3c30e5.png""https://${yourOktaDomain}/login/step-up/redirect?stateToken=00quAZYqYjXg9DZhS5UzE1wrJuQ6KKb_kzOeH7OGB5""https://${yourOktaDomain}/assets/img/logos/salesforce_logo.dbd7e0b4de118a1dae1c39d60a3c30e5.png""https://${yourOktaDomain}/api/v1/authn/factors/opf1cla0yyvOBWxuC1d8/verify""https://${yourOktaDomain}/api/v1/authn/factors/smsph8F1esz8LlSjo0g3/verify""https://${yourOktaDomain}/assets/img/logos/salesforce_logo.dbd7e0b4de118a1dae1c39d60a3c30e5.png""Invalid or unknown audience '0oa6gva7owNAhDam50h7'. "credentialId": "dade.murphy@example.com" "factorType": "webauthn", "stateToken": "007ucIX7PATyn94hsHfOLVaXAmOBkKHWnOOLG43bsb", "warnBeforePasswordExpired": false }''{ See https://www.duosecurity.com/docs/duoweb for more info. }'"https://${yourOktaDomain}/api/v1/authn/factors/fwfbaopNw5CCGJTu20g4/lifecycle/activate""Your passcode doesn't match our records. It can help you learn the nitty-gritty of software development and how to overcome its everyday challenges.
It handles things such as a password-expired, locked out, or multi-factor challenge required states.This class contains the logic needed to collect and display JSPs to advance a user through This class contains all the hooks that interact with Okta’s And, by now I assume you see the pattern, but in case not: you should also create this class in the same package.
"phoneNumber": "+1-555-415-1337" -->'https://${yourOktaDomain}/api/v1/authn/factors/dsflnpo99zpfMyaij0g3/lifecycle/duoCallback'"20111zMXPaEe_lEw7pg2Ub810HDkpBwzSVBEPBRpA87LH5sW3Jj35_x"'{ "passCode": "5275875498" "'{ "API call exceeded rate limit due to too many requests. "provider": "OKTA", "password": "correcthorsebatterystaple", "stateToken": "00lMJySRYNz3u_rKQrsLvLrzxiARgivP8FB_1gpmVb" I am able to successfully authenticate through a web browser, so I am attempting to reproduce the same series of API calls executed in the web browser within the RestAssured API in Java. "factorType": "sms", "deviceToken": "26q43Ak9Eh04p7H6Nnx0m69JqYOrfVBY" "'{ The enrollment process starts with getting an Enrolls a user with a WebAuthn Factor. "stateToken": "007ucIX7PATyn94hsHfOLVaXAmOBkKHWnOOLG43bsb", "username": "dade.murphy@example.com", "passCode": "cccccceukngdfgkukfctkcvfidnetljjiknckkcjulji" 19 2 2 bronze badges. "stateToken":"00BClWr4T-mnIqPV8dHkOQlwEIXxB4LLSfBVt7BxsM" "stateToken": "007ucIX7PATyn94hsHfOLVaXAmOBkKHWnOOLG43bsb" Join the DZone community and get the full member experience.To get started, we’ll use a simple application I wrote that shares secret family recipes. "stateToken": "007ucIX7PATyn94hsHfOLVaXAmOBkKHWnOOLG43bsb",
"stateToken": "007ucIX7PATyn94hsHfOLVaXAmOBkKHWnOOLG43bsb",